Integrating NVR Systems into Smart City Infrastructure

As cities around the world continue to embrace digital transformation, the demand for intelligent, interconnected surveillance systems has grown rapidly. Network Video Recorder (NVR) systems are at the heart of this evolution, providing the foundation for secure, efficient, and data-driven urban management. By integrating NVR systems into smart city infrastructure, municipalities can enhance safety, optimize operations, and improve citizens’ quality of life.

The Role of NVR Systems in Smart Cities

NVR systems serve as the central hub for video data collected from IP cameras installed across a city—whether at intersections, transportation hubs, public parks, or government buildings. Unlike traditional DVRs, NVRs record and manage digital video streams over IP networks, enabling real-time monitoring and advanced analytics.

In a smart city context, these systems go beyond simple video storage. They connect seamlessly with IoT devices, AI analytics platforms, and city-wide command centers to support intelligent decision-making and automated responses.

Key Benefits of NVR Integration in Urban Environments

1. Enhanced Public Safety

By leveraging high-definition IP cameras and AI-powered NVRs, city authorities can detect and respond to incidents—such as accidents, theft, or emergencies—in real time. Integration with facial recognition and license plate recognition systems enables rapid identification and improved situational awareness.

2. Centralized Monitoring and Control

Smart cities rely on centralized operation centers to manage multiple data streams efficiently. NVR systems enable unified video management, allowing operators to monitor thousands of cameras across various districts through one platform.

3. Data-Driven Urban Management

With advanced video analytics, NVRs can collect insights about traffic flow, crowd density, and public behavior. These data points help planners optimize traffic lights, improve public transportation, and design safer urban spaces.

4. Scalability and Connectivity

Modern NVR solutions are highly scalable and compatible with cloud-based infrastructure. As a city expands, additional cameras and sensors can easily be added to the network without major system overhauls.

5. Cybersecurity and Reliability

Smart city networks handle vast amounts of sensitive data. Today’s NVR systems include encryption, multi-level access control, and secure remote connections to protect against cyber threats while ensuring 24/7 operational reliability.

Integrating with Smart City Ecosystems

The true potential of NVR systems is realized when they are integrated into the broader smart city ecosystem. This involves connecting with:

  • Traffic management systems** for real-time congestion analysis
  • Public safety networks** for emergency response coordination
  • Environmental sensors** for monitoring air quality and weather conditions
  • IoT platforms** for automated alerts and predictive maintenance

By combining visual intelligence with sensor data, city operators can make proactive decisions that enhance safety, reduce energy use, and improve mobility.
